Honda reorganizes motorcycle business and will merge combustion engine and electric models from 2026

Honda is reorganizing its global motorcycle business. Starting in April 2026, combustion engines and electric models will be developed and marketed under a joint management structure.
  • New organizational structure effective April 1, 2026
  • Joint management for combustion engines and electric motorcycles
  • The goal is more efficient use of resources and faster decision-making

The global motorcycle industry is undergoing a period of rapid change. Technological developments, regulatory requirements, and changing market demands are forcing manufacturers to regularly review their internal structures. Against this backdrop, Honda has announced a comprehensive reorganization of its motorcycle business, which is set to take effect on April 1, 2026.

Joint management for combustion engines and electric motorcycles

At the heart of the realignment is the merger of previously separate divisions for motorcycles with combustion engines and electric drives. In the future, sales, business strategy, and product development for both drive concepts will be managed under a unified management structure. The new structure thus covers the entire value chain, from strategic planning and technical development to market launch.

Honda is responding to the increasing dynamism of the global environment. Market trends and technological developments are changing faster than originally expected. An integrated organization should make it possible to identify these changes earlier and offer new products in a more targeted manner and at the right time.

Electrification moves from planning to implementation

According to the company, Honda’s electrification strategy in the motorcycle sector is entering a new phase. Whereas the focus has been primarily on planning and groundwork up to now, the emphasis is now shifting more toward concrete implementation. At the same time, motorcycles with combustion engines remain the highest-volume business in many markets.

The parallel development of both drive concepts places high demands on organization and cost control. Electric models require short learning cycles and rapid adjustments, while combustion engine programs continue to be geared toward stable sales figures. The merger of the previously separate structures is intended to reduce conflicting goals and avoid duplication of work.

More efficient use of resources and faster decisions

With the new organizational structure, Honda is pursuing the goal of simplifying internal coordination processes. Separate responsibilities for electric models and combustion engines could have led to different priorities and slower decision-making processes in the past. A unified view of the entire motorcycle portfolio is intended to remove these hurdles.

According to Honda, integrated management should also help to deploy financial and human resources in a more targeted manner. Development decisions could be made more quickly and products brought to market faster from the concept phase. In a rapidly changing market environment, the company expects this to increase its competitiveness.

Part of a more comprehensive reorganization

The changes in the motorcycle business are part of a larger organizational realignment at Honda Global. At the same time, the automotive and power products divisions are also being restructured. Overall, the new structure is intended to strengthen the group’s ability to respond more flexibly to technological and market changes and create new value for customers.

It remains to be seen how the realignment will specifically affect upcoming models and market strategies. What is clear, however, is that Honda will no longer strictly separate its motorcycle activities according to drive types, but will instead view them as a unified business area.

What does this mean for me as a motorcyclist?

For motorcyclists, the reorganization is likely to have mainly indirect effects. If Honda integrates the development, strategy, and sales of combustion engines and electric models more closely, new models could be more closely aligned with real market needs and appear more quickly. At the same time, classic motorcycles are not expected to lose importance in the short term, as they continue to account for a large proportion of sales figures. In the medium to long term, however, the new structure could lead to greater model diversity, with electric and conventional motorcycles more clearly positioned and technology, price, and intended use more clearly differentiated.
